China’s manufacturing PMI at 49.0 in Oct

By LucasOctober 31, 20251 Min Read
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


This photo taken on Oct 16, 2025 shows a view of a factory of Jiangsu Yueda Kia Motors Co Ltd in Yancheng, East China”s Jiangsu province. [Photo/Xinhua]

The purchasing managers’ index of China’s manufacturing industry came in at 49.0 in October, down 0.8 percentage points from the previous month, data released by the National Bureau of Statistics showed on Friday.

The non-manufacturing business activity index was 50.1 in October, up 0.1 percentage points from the previous month, moving into the expansionary range.

By industry, the business activity index for the service industry reached 50.2, also rising 0.1 percentage points month-on-month, while the business activity indexes for service industries including rail transport, air transport, postal services, accommodation, culture, sports and entertainment remained at or above the high expansion range of 60.0.

Furthermore, the composite PMI output index stood at 50.0 in October, down 0.6 percentage points from the previous month and hovering at the threshold, indicating that overall production and business activities of Chinese enterprises remained stable, according to the National Bureau of Statistics.
